The band, Anathema and the track “The Lost Song Part 2” from their 2015 release “Distant Satellites.”  This unique band consists of the three Cavanagh brothers in addition to the brother and sister duo of John and Lee Douglas. Here’s the complete line-up of this Liverpool band and their respective instruments:

Anathema _1

Vincent Cavanagh – rhythm and acoustic guitars, keyboards, programming, lead vocals
Daniel Cavanagh – lead guitar, keyboards, piano  lead and backing vocals
Jamie Cavanagh – bass
John Douglas – drums, percussion, keyboards
Lee Douglas – backing vocals , lead vocals
Daniel Cardoso – keyboards, drums

The track, “The Lost Song Part 2” begins simply enough with understated piano.  Soon the beautiful female voice of Lee Douglas begins to fill your airwaves.  The groove is mellow and extremely pleasing to this listener’s ear.  Then the lyrics begin and the pace of this song changes dramatically.

The entire track is devoid of any overpowering guitar solos. Instead it relies on piano, keyboards and guitar to power it through.  And oh, the lush lead voice of Lee Douglas is a delight to be taken in.  “The Lost Song Part 2” is a true progressive rock ballad if such a thing does truly exist.  As the track effortlessly moves to its’ end, the soundscape of this band is both harmonious and discordant at the same time.  And the overall effect on this listener is overwhelming.

There’s an excellent video on YouTube that I’ve included here.  It features clips from the 2011 science fiction movie drama, “Perfect Sense” starring Ewan McGregor and Eva Green.  I have to admit I’ve never heard of the movie before but I’m certainly glad I’ve stumbled on this edited clip to this moving song.  The movie and this video focus on the relationship between their 2 characters as an epidemic spreads across the world whereby humans lose their sensory perceptions one at a time. Surprisingly this song does not appear on the soundtrack for “Perfect Sense” nor is it the official song for the movie. Still, having 2 gifted actors appear in an edited clip for this song only heightens the experience.
